Q: Is 242,014,410 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 242,014,410 is a composite number.

Why is 242,014,410 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 242,014,410 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 9 10 11 15 18 22 30 33 37 45 55 66 74 90 99 110 111 165 185 198 222 330 333 370 407 495 555 666 814 990 1,110 1,221 1,665 2,035 2,442 3,330 3,663 4,070 6,105 6,607 7,326 12,210 13,214 18,315 19,821 33,035 36,630 39,642 59,463 66,070 72,677 99,105 118,926 145,354 198,210 218,031 244,459 297,315 363,385 436,062 488,918 594,630 654,093 726,770 733,377 1,090,155 1,222,295 1,308,186 1,466,754 2,180,310 2,200,131 2,444,590 2,689,049 3,270,465 3,666,885 4,400,262 5,378,098 6,540,930 7,333,770 8,067,147 11,000,655 13,445,245 16,134,294 22,001,310 24,201,441 26,890,490 40,335,735 48,402,882 80,671,470 121,007,205 and 242,014,410, with no remainder.

Since 242,014,410 cannot be divided by just 1 and 242,014,410, it is a composite number.
